主机参考:VPS测评参考推荐/专注分享VPS服务器优惠信息!若您是商家可以在本站进行投稿,查看详情!此外我们还提供软文收录、PayPal代付、广告赞助等服务,查看详情! |
我们发布的部分优惠活动文章可能存在时效性,购买时建议在本站搜索商家名称可查看相关文章充分了解该商家!若非中文页面可使用Edge浏览器同步翻译!PayPal代付/收录合作 |
Linux文件搜索指南
在Linux操作系统中,文件搜索是我们经常使用的操作之一。无论您是在寻找特定文件、具有特定内容的文件还是具有特定文件类型或权限的文件,您都可以通过Linux强大的搜索命令找到它。本文将介绍几种常用的Linux文件搜索命令,并附上详细的代码示例,以帮助读者更好地理解和应用这些命令。
1.查找特定文件当我们想要查找具有特定名称的文件时,我们可以使用find命令。下面是一个例子。假设我们要查找所有以““结尾的文件。txt“在当前目录及其子目录中:
找到。-名称& quot*.txt & quot在上面的命令中。代表当前目录,-name“*。txt & quot意思是查找文件名以“结尾的文件。txt”。如果您想查找具有特定文件名的文件,只需替换*。txt和相应的文件名。
2.查找包含特定内容的文件有时我们需要查找包含特定内容的文件,这可以通过结合使用grep命令和find命令来实现。假设我们想在当前目录及其子目录中找到一个包含关键字“hello world”的文件:
grep -rl "你好世界& quot*在上述命令中,-r表示递归搜索,-l表示仅显示包含关键字的文件名,而不显示特定内容。*表示当前目录。如果要查找特定目录,可以将*替换为相应的目录路径。如果要查找不区分大小写的内容,可以添加-i参数。
3.查找特定的文件类型当我们想要查找特定的文件类型时,我们可以使用-type参数来组合查找命令。假设我们想找到当前目录及其子目录中的所有图片文件:
找到。-f-name & quot;*.jpg & quot-o-name & quot;*.png & quot在上面的命令中,-type f表示查找文件而不是目录,-name“*。jpg & quot-o-name & quot;*.png & quot意思是查找以““结尾的文件。jpg“或”。png”。
4.查找具有特定权限的文件有时我们需要查找具有特定权限的文件,我们可以使用-perm参数来组合查找命令。假设我们想在当前目录及其子目录中查找用户可以读写的所有文件:
找到。-在上面的命令中键入f -perm /u=rw ,-perm参数后跟权限掩码,/u=rw表示用户可以读写。u代表用户,G代表组,O代表其他用户,=代表平等,+代表至少包括,-代表完全合规。
通过以上示例,读者可以更好地了解如何在Linux系统中查找文件。当然,Linux中还有许多其他强大的文件搜索命令和参数,读者可以根据自己的具体需求进一步研究和探索。希望这篇文章对读者有所帮助!
这几篇文章你可能也喜欢:
- 暂无相关推荐文章
本文由主机参考刊发,转载请注明:指南:linux文件定位技巧(Linux location oom) https://zhujicankao.com/116683.html
评论前必须登录!
注册